Kristian Lindbom (Born 18 September, 1989) is an Australian racing car driver. He is a race winner in the Australian Formula Ford Championship and the Australian Formula 3 Championship. He is also a 5 time Australian Go-Karting champion.
Formula Ford
Kristian competed in the Australian Formula Ford Championship from 2006 through to 2008 for Borland Racing Developments (2006–2007) and Sonic Motor Racing Services (2008). Over the 3 years he won 6 races, 28 podiums, 3 pole positions and 4 fastest laps.
Formula 3
In the 2009 and 2010 seasons Kristian had showings in Formula 3 on three occasions with limited success due to a lack of testing laps prior to races.
In 2011, At the Darwin round of V8 Supercars where Kristian was working for Lucas Dumbrell Motorsport, a car capable of race wins became vacant. Kristian took the opportunity with both hands and withdrew $2,000 from his credit card called on a big favor from a Lucas Dumbrell Motorsport team sponsor to pay for his tires and called on each team member to chip in $50 each for fuel. 15 minutes before the first qualifying session Kristian fronted with his helmet and the money, sat in the car for the first time, and the first time in 14 months, as he drove out of the garage and finished the session in 1st place.
Kristian went on to win the inaugural City of Darwin Cup.
V8 Supercars
Kristian made a successful test debut with Lucas Dumbrell Motorsport in August 2011. He completed 25 laps at Winton Motor Raceway and posted times competitive to current V8 Supercar competition. In September of 2011 he tested for Walkinshaw Racing at Winton
